Getting Started with Snow Rider Obby Parkour

When I first launched the game, I was greeted by a sleek and intuitive menu system that allowed me to choose from a variety of game modes, including solo and split-screen multiplayer. The game’s controls are responsive and easy to learn, with the W, A, S, and D keys handling movement and the space bar controlling jumps. I noticed that the game also supports double jumps, which adds a whole new level of complexity and excitement to the gameplay. For example, when I reached the second level, I found myself using the double jump feature to navigate through challenging obstacles and steep slopes.

Game Modes and Features

Snow Rider Obby Parkour offers a range of game modes that cater to different types of players. The distance mode, for instance, challenges players to cover as much distance as possible within a set time limit. I found this mode to be particularly exciting, as it required me to master my snowboarding skills and navigate through the terrain with precision. The game also features a massive open world, which I explored with glee, discovering new trails and secret areas that added to the game’s replay value. For players who enjoy competition, the game’s racing mode allows for split-screen multiplayer, where two players can compete against each other in a thrilling race to the finish line.
